-
Notifications
You must be signed in to change notification settings - Fork 67
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Delete now obsolete Jobs in Releng Jenkins #1060
Comments
PR #657 is now over a year old and I wonder if we can now reconsider if the two deploy jobs for the parent-pom and sdk-target-pom can be deleted?
Furthermore I wonder if we can now remove all these obsolete SWT-native jobs? Or are they used to back-port changes in the SWT natives if necessary, although I'm in doubt that this would work (but I haven't looked at these jobs in a while). |
Cleaning up stale jobs is fine by me and people had enough time to react if these were really needed so please proceed with the cleanup. |
@sravanlakkimsetti do you also want to comment on this one? |
Now that eclipse-equinox/equinox#603 has been submitted all jobs in the launcher group are obsolete as well: Once the new Equinox pipeline has proofed to work well, I'll delete all manually created jobs of the launcher jobs, unless somebody objects. I think shortly after the next release, so in the beginning of the 4.33 cycle would be a good target for that. |
Now that the SimRel for 2024-06 happened last week and I didn't become aware of any problem regarding the Equinox launcher binaries or (for longer) the SWT binaries, I think the grace period of the jobs intended to be deleted has passed. If there are no objections by Friday this week, I'll continue to delete ALL JOBS in the following views plus the mentioned views themself:
These jobs have already been deleted by somebody else. |
The pom.xml files deployed in these jobs are already deployed as part of the master and maintenance branch builds of this 'eclipse.platform.releng.aggregator' repository. Part of eclipse-platform#1060
I have to correct this statement, these jobs just have been renamed. So the same applies.
And will remove them from the seed job via #2139. |
The pom.xml files deployed in these jobs are already deployed as part of the master and maintenance branch builds of this 'eclipse.platform.releng.aggregator' repository. Part of #1060
All seven jobs in the The jobs With that this issue is completed. Although there are probably more jobs that can be removed, but that's for another issue. |
PR #657 made the following Jenkins jobs obsolete (for the mater, it was argued that they are a.t.m. needed for backports)
With eclipse-platform/eclipse.platform.swt#514 all jobs in the following view are obsolete
With eclipse-equinox/equinox#603 all jobs in the following view are also obsolete:
On the long run those jobs should be deleted to not litter the Jenkins with abandoned jobs.
The main question is when?
This at least serves as a reminder.
The text was updated successfully, but these errors were encountered: